Do not try to do a restore at install if the user is not ready for
backup.

Bug: 144155744

This solves a bug which makes staged installs hang. This is
happening because when installing, the PackageManager is waiting for a response to be sent back from
the BackupManagerService after it finishes restoring. In the case of staged installs which happen at boot,
isUserReadyForBackup is false, so the method does nothing and the
PackageManager keeps on waiting on a response.
